There is growing concern that emissions of carbon dioxide (CO2) and other greenhouse gases (GHG) to the atmosphere is resulting in climate change with undefined consequences. This has led to a comprehensive program to develop technologies to reduce CO2 emissions from coalfired power plants. New technologies, based upon both advanced combustion and gasification technologies hold promise for economically achieving CO2 reductions through improved efficiencies. However, if the United States decides to embark on a CO2 emissions control program employing these new and cleaner technologies in new plants only, it may not be sufficient. It may also be necessary to reduce emissions from the existing fleet of power plants
